This heartfelt comic drama from the directing duo behind The Intouchables uncovers problems in the French medical system. For twenty years, Bruno (Vincent Cassel) and Malik (Reda Kateb) have been living and working in the world of autistic children and teenagers. They are committed to training young adults who care for these “extremely complex cases”. Bruno and Malik are frustrated by the lack of consistent funding and institutional support for those in need in this feel-good and thoughtful comedy based on real-life individuals.
